Sport was born from play. And play began when we felt safe—when we had the space and energy to simply play. So, shall we play? Will we be at the starting line together?
A performance full of movement, emotion, imagery, euphoria, anger, and triumph. Sport as a gateway to themes that touch everyone—whether they love sport or despise it. Cirk La Putyka returns to the very beginning. To the roots. To the question of why it all started. Back to ancient Athens, to the sun and the dust, to reflect on the lives of today’s professional athletes. What does the journey toward a dream look like? What goes through the mind a second before the starting shot? What does it feel like to return to training after an injury? What do athletes go through when nothing is working, when everything hurts? When do they want to be alone—and when do they feel abandoned?
